Agreement on the Prohibition of Attack Against Nuclear Installations and Facilities The Agreement on the Prohibition of Attack against Nuclear Installations and Facilities was signed on 31st December, 1988, by the then Pakistani Prime Minister Benazir Bhutto and Indian PM Rajiv Gandhi. The treaty came into force on 27th January, 1991. The recent one is the 33rd consecutive exchange of such lists between the two countries, the first one having taken place on 01st January, 1992. Background: While other factors might have played a role, the direct trigger for the negotiation and signing of the agreement was the tension generated by the 1986-87 Brasstacks exercise by the Indian Army. Operation Brasstacks was a military exercise conducted in the Indian state of Rajasthan, near the Pakistan border. 2 / 5 Q2. Consider the following statements: The landmark judgment in Justice K.S. Section 132 of the Income Tax Act,1961 The section was introduced in 1961, as part of Income Tax Act,1961, to replace the Taxation on Income (Investigation Commission) Act, 1947, which was struck down by the Supreme Court in Suraj Mall Mohta vs A.V. Visvanatha Sastri (1954) on the ground that it treated a certain class of assesses differently from others, thereby violating the guarantee of equal treatment contained in Article 14 of the Constitution. The original income-tax law in 1922 lacked search and seizure powers. Section 132 of the Income-Tax Act, 1961, empowers the tax authorities to conduct searches and seizures of persons and properties, without any prior judicial warrant, if they have a “reason to believe” that the person has concealed or evaded income. 3 / 5 Q3. Key Facts About the KLI-SOFC Project Lakshadweep required digital connectivity, prompting a high-capacity submarine cable link due to limitations in satellite communication, marked by inadequate bandwidth to meet growing demand. KLI-SOFC Project The KLI-SOFC project will lead to an increase in internet speed, unlocking new possibilities and opportunities. The project introduces Submarine Optic Fiber Cable connectivity for the first time in Lakshadweep since independence. Fiber optics, or optical fiber, refers to the technology that transmits information as light pulses along a glass or plastic fiber. The Department of Telecommunications (DOT) funded by the Universal Services Obligation Fund (USOF), completed the project. Bharat Sanchar Nigam Limited (BSNL) was the Project Executing Agency. 4 / 5 Q4. Consider the following statements: India topped the list of source markets for tourism in Sri Lanka in 2023. Tourism occupies an important place in the Sri Lankan economy as the top foreign revenue source. Tourism contributed US$2.1 billion, up from US$1.1 billion achieved the previous year. With the resumption of air travel between Jaffna and Chennai in December 2022, connectivity between the two countries has improved compared to last year. Additionally, connectivity between Colombo and Mumbai has also improved with daily flights operating in the sector. Additionally, the commencement of ferry services between Nagapattinam and Kankesanthurai has also boosted the connectivity between the two countries. 5 / 5 Q5. DRDO is now focusing on high-end un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s), while the industry has the capacity for smaller drones. DRDO is creating drone-based systems and anti-drone systems based on the requirements of user agencies. DRDO has developed a comprehensive integrated anti-drone system that includes the detection, identification, and neutralization of drones. The three services have already placed 23 orders with BEL for the technology developed by DRDO. Transfer of Technology (TOT) for the above technologies has been handed over to private industries, including BEL, Adani, Larsen & Toubro (L&T), and ICOM. This technology is capable of countering all types of drone attacks, soft kill, and hard kill, including micro drones, which are being developed in DRDO. In addition, Tapas Medium Altitude Long Endurance (MALE) UAV developed for Intelligence, Surveillance, Target Acquisition, and Reconnaissance (ISTAR) applications is in the advanced stage of developmental trials. Archer, a short-range armed UAV for reconnaissance, surveillance, and low-intensity conflict, is being developed and developmental flight tests are in progress.
